1 There are approximately 200,000 protected areas in the world, which cover around 14.6% of the world s land and around 2.8% of the oceans. Protected areas (PA) can take on many different forms, such as national parks, wilderness areas, community conserved areas, nature reserves and privately owned reserves. Protected areas provide a wide range of social, environmental and economic benefits to people and communities worldwide. Clean water, clean air, access to food sources, buffers of weather events, cultural and spiritual values, and raw materials for consumers, are some of the ecosystem services that ensure the well-being of humanity, especially the poor who most directly rely on them. More than instruments for conserving nature, protected areas are vital to respond to some of today s most pressing challenges, including food and water security, human health and well-being, disaster risk reduction and climate change. 2 Berat Tomorri National Park consists of a mountain terrain rich in ground and underground waters. One can find there tree species like Fir (Abies), Black Pine (Pinus nigra), Beech (Fagus sylvatica), Oak (Quercus cerris), and hazelnut plantations. It is a home for six endemic plants, among them Astragalus autroni, an endemic specie found only in Tomorri Mountain. Mountain s breathtaking landscapes are a great inspiration for the artists. The Osumi Canyons, the so called Colorado of Albania, are located in the Tomorri National Park. The canyons are 13 km long, 4 to 35 meters wide and 70 to 80 meters deep, with vertical slopes at the foot of the lively Osumi river run. The local communities of protected areas in the Berat region have a tradition for livestock grazing, as well as for the production of the tomato of Tomorri, onions of Lybesha and honey. In addition to scientific and economic values, the park is of high importance for the aesthetic, recreational, cultural and touristic development of the region. 3 Dibra Korab Koritnik Natural Park stretches in two regions: Kukes and Diber and has a size of 55,550 hectares. Some of the nature monuments it offers to the park visitors are Grama Mirrors, Vlesha Cold Water, Buroviku i Begjunecit, Bellov Cave, Bellova Natural Water Springs, Pocesti Waterfall, Guri i Kërcinit. The Protected Areas of Dibra region are known for their remarkable natural values but also for their unique cultural values, history, traditional costumes, characteristic houses, traditions and customs which are preserved and transmitted even today through local celebrations, dances, wedding songs, rites and popular games. The shearing feast is organized at the Korab-Koritnik Protected Area (Kalaja e Dodës ) as well as the Saint George day, Vintage Fair is held in Peshkopi every October, and so on. The region is known for fruit trees and agro-dairy products and the production of apples, walnuts, chestnuts, plums, pears, potatoes and for raising Rude sheep (Kalaja e Dodës ). All these represent special values of the region of great attraction for tourists and visitors. View of Korab-Koritnik RAPA Dibër
4 Durrës The most important protected areas in Durrës region are the Qafështama National Park and Rushkulli Managed Nature Reserve. The National Park of Qafështama resides in the edge mountains over Qafështama pass, about 25 kilometers east of Kruja, with a beautiful mountain scenery, some small lakes and major sources consisting mainly of pine forests. The renown Source of the Queen Mother is located within the park. The Durrës region is also rich in nature monuments including Cape Rodonit (surrounded by rocky formations 25 m high, featuring a Scanderbeg castle and a church); Arramerasit Planes in Fushe Krujë (a group of plane trees over 20 m high and with a trunk diameter between 1 and 1,3 m); Gorge of Vaja or Vaja Rock in Kruja (formed by the Droja River erosion over the limestone rocks million years ago). The legend says that after the invasion of Kruja in 1478, ninety local women and girls jumped from the rock 200 meters high, holding hands, to avoid being imprisoned by the Turks. The mourning of the local community for those brave women named the rock Shkëmbi i Vajit (Mourning Rock). Kallmi beach RAPA Durrës
5 Elbasan Shebenik-Jabllanicë National Park is known as one of the largest and most beautiful parks that has a very rich inventory of both flora and fauna, as well as more than one thousands water springs. One of the oldest mosques of the area is found in the Zgosht village. In Fushë-Studë there is a very picturesque lake where the surroundings resemble a beautiful spring balcony offering a spectacular panoramic view of the Lake. The Ice Cave and the Eremite Cave are found in the park, dating back to the 2nd and 3rd century of the Byzantine rule. The park is characterized by several thousand hectares of grassland and a variety of flowers ranging from the most beautiful and least frequent Narcisium poeticum to Albanicum Lilium. Within the park there are over 14 small glacial lakes of great beauty and three rivers, with a total length of 22 km. Some of the rare species that inhabit the area are Marten, Wild Boar, Roe Deer, Chamois, Lynx, Grouse, Golden Eagle, Trout, Otter, etc. View of Shebenik Jabllanicë RAPA Elbasan
6 Fier Divjaka-Karavasta National Park is home to Dalmatian Pelican (Pelecanus crispus) and to more than 200 other wild birds. At the Karavasta oasis one can find the 410 years old Wild Pine, a designated Nature Monument. Divjaka beach is a strip of about 15 kilometres of white sand that borders with a pine forest - a destination for thousands of tourists and visitors. Divjaka-Karavasta National Park offers a great variety of natural, religious, historic and archeological attractions, including a Byzantine Church from XVIII century in New Karavasta village, Ardenica Monastery from XVIII-XIV century near Kolonja village, Lemon hill (Ancient City of Anisas) which have archaeological values and the Boshtova castle - the only castle in Albania built in the lowlands. 7 Gjirokastra Hotovë - Dangëlli National Park is characterized by a colourful biodiversity where the greatness of nature meets the rich variety of ecosystems. The forestry habitat is composed of large areas covered by the Macedonian Fir (Abies borisii-regis) and other kinds of endemic species like Mountain Maple (Acer spicatum), Oriental Hornbeam (Carpinus orientalis), Turkey Oak (Quercus cerris), Hungarian Oak (Quercus frainetto), etc. The Park hosts a variety of bushes such as Strawberry Tree (Arbutus unedo), Common Juniper (Juniperus communis), Blackberry (Rubus fruticosus), etc. which in combination with high forests form a rich habitat for Grey Bear, Roe deer, Wild Boar. Hotovë Dangëlli National Park offers to its visitors the sights of picturesque canyons of Langarica, Kamencka and Borocka, the ancient bridges of Katiu and Dashi and the mysterious caves. In the park, one can find the thermal healing waters of Bënja. One should not leave this park without tasting the traditional cuisine and the raki of Përmet. Katiu bridge, Bënjë N. Giglio
8 Korça Liqeni i Prespës së madhe RAPA Korçë Shared between Macedonia, Albania and Greece, the lakes of Prespa, Small Prespa and Ohrid are beautiful territories with clean and healthy environment, rich in cultural and traditional diversity. The surrounding mountains, reaching the altitude of 2200 m are covered by different vegetation zones varying from Oak, to Greek Juniper to Beach forests up to subalpine meadows and White-bark pine. The combination of diverse types of habitats ensures the presence of various animal species. The lakes play a particular role for migratory water birds, and are crucial for the prosperity and health of its inhabitants. The variety of local pastoral and agricultural products witnesses the long history of human presence with its cultural heritage, traditions and the balanced use of resources. The visitors of this region can enjoy the typical relaxing summer holidays, or go for hiking, cycling, swimming, paragliding, food and drink tasting, visiting cultural sites and joining traditional festivals. Ohrid-Prespa Watershed is designated as UNESCO Trans-boundary Biosphere Reserve.
9 Kukës Protected Areas of Kukës region occupy about 22.3% of its total size. It includes the Gashi River, a strict nature reserve (proposed to be included on the World Heritage List), National Park of Valbona Valley, Natural Park of Korab-Koritnik, Protected Area of Drini i Bardhë River and 53 nature monuments. The National Park of Valbona Valley, with a size of 8000 hectares, is one of the pearls of the Albanian Alps. It is the most visited park in Albania, hosting both national and international visitors. Korab-Koritnik Natural Park stretches in two regions: Kukes and Diber and has a size of 55,550.2 hectares. Protected areas of the region are distinguished not only for their outstanding natural values but also for their unique cultural and traditional values. The Chestnut festival is becoming a tradition in Tropoja, but the area is also renowned for the special potato variety and local sheep and goat breeds (rude sheep, Hasi goat). 10 Lezha The most important protected area in Lezha region is the Managed Natura Reserve of Kune-Vain, composed of a lagoon system of Kune and Vain, connected by the Drin River so that various habitats are integrated in one sole ecosystem. It is a home to endangered wildlife such as Cormorants (Phalacrocorax Pygmeus) and Otter (Lutra lutra). The wetland of Kune-Vain is characterized by the presence of sea waters, lagoons and marshes, as well as freshwater (rivers and draining ditches) which enable the presence of various types of fish with high economic values. Similarly important is the Patoku lagoon located further south in the Drini bay. Other important natural areas worth visiting in Lezha include the Small Suka cave (a 40 meters long karst cave), Shkopeti gorge (a 60 meters long gorge carved by the Mati River) and Rana e Hedhun, a sand dune created by the wind on a seashore, about 600 meters long and 100 meters wide). 11 Shkodra View of Lake Skadar SBI/M. De Sanctis Skadar Lake, with a total size of 368 square kilometers (149 km in Albania), is the biggest lake in the Balkan Peninsula. Rich with underwater flora (abondance of macrophyte species), Lake Skadar counts more than 238 types of water plants. It is one of the most important wetlands in Europe for wintering of Waterfowl, with a known capacity of about quarter million individuals and 283 type of identified birds, 168 out of which belong to water habitats. The globally endangered Dalmatian Pelican (Pelecanus crispus) resides and nests at Skadar Lake. Skadar Lake, where mountainous terrain harmonizes with the lowlands and water, invites the visitors to experience tourist places like Shiroke and Zogaj, and the picturesque spots of Bregu i Ranes, Bishtiqendia, Stërbeqi, Grili, Shegani, etc. This is where the visitors can go fishing, enjoy water sports (canoeing, sailing), boat tours, biking and so on. They can also visit Taraboshi Mountain and the forests and hills from Buna River to Hani i Hotit.

13 Vlora Llogara National Park serves as a bridge to the Ionian shores, with a specific climate where the fresh mountain air mixes with the sea breeze. The park is dominated by a wide variety of habitats including natural or semi-natural, artificial or man-made ones. The Flag Pine is a Nature Monument, found some 910 meters above sea level. It is a Black Pine (Pinus nigra) that is more than a hundred years old, 20 meters high and with a log diameter of 75 cm. It has taken the shape of the flag as a result of strong winds from the southeast. Llogara National Park represents a great example of the co-existence of the inhabitants with nature, where socio-economic interests very often go hand in hand with nature protection. In the vicinity of Llogara National Park there are two centers, Dukat Fushe and Dukat Fshat where local community dedicates to agriculture and livestock breeding, growing fruit trees and maintaining vineyards. 15 31 July World Ranger Day Protected areas give us water, food, medicine and clean air, and help reduce risks and consequences of floods and storms, while providing homes and jobs to people. Worldwide, protected areas are all managed by skilled rangers from Indigenous Peoples, local communities, private organisations, as well as those working in conservation agencies. Many of them risk their lives to protect our planet s most precious natural areas. They are nature defenders, and thanks to them the global community can continue its efforts to conserve the species and ecosystems that sustain us all. In Albania, in 2015 National Agency for Protected Areas was recognized as a unique responsible body dedicated to Protected Areas and in each region its staff is building up its capacities and performing rangers duties. The main responsibility of a park ranger is protecting and supervising designated outdoor areas. Rangers patrol the protected areas making sure no illegal activities are happening. They might be called on to conduct search-and-rescue missions and to help fight fires. Park rangers, through interpretation, help visitors understand nature and learn about the park s features and importance. They might be responsible for giving guided tours or presentations of the park.
